The Russians put two former defense ministers of Ukraine and the former head of the General Staff on the wanted list. Russian propagandists write about it.

We are talking about Stepan Poltorak, Valery Galetey and Viktor Muzhenko. In a terrorist country, they are accused of “genocide of the civilian Russian-speaking population in Donbass”.

Earlier, the Russians put on the wanted list the Commander-in-Chief of the Armed Forces of Ukraine Valeriy Zaluzhny, the Commander of the Ground Forces, Colonel-General Alexander Syrsky, and the Deputy Chief of the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, Commander of the Joint Forces, Lieutenant-General Sergei Naev.

As propagandists write, we can talk about previous accusations of the alleged use of prohibited means and methods of warfare by Ukrainian troops..

Thus, as in the case of Zaluzhny, the Russians admitted that they did not liquidate Syrsky. Similar fakes were invented by enemy “military correspondents” in early May.

Deputy Defense Minister Anna Malyar explained that the Russian reports about the alleged disappearance of the commanders of the Armed Forces of Ukraine are intended to have a psychological impact on Ukrainians, demoralize the Defense Forces and get a short-term hype on the topic to raise the spirit of their own troops.
